Art Fort Lauderdale Announces Participating Artists for Third Edition, January

24 – 27, 2019

With strong returning artists and notable first time additions, Art Fort Lauderdale continues its
global reach by including artists from Argentina, Puerto Rico, Canada, London, Italy, France, The
Islands of the Bahamas and Trinidad & Tobago among many others.

Fort Lauderdale, FL, January 22, 2019 --(PR.com)-- Art Fort Lauderdale, The Art Fair on the Water,
today announced the premier list of artists for its third annual edition, January 24-27, 2019 with the new
boarding location of Pier Sixty-Six Hotel & Marina (2301 SE 17th St, Fort Lauderdale, FL 33316).
Marking its largest edition to date, Art Fort Lauderdale welcomes over 160 artists representing multiple
countries and cities from around the world. Countries represented at the 2019 fair include United States,
Argentina, Puerto Rico, Canada, London, Italy, France, The Islands of the Bahamas and Trinidad &
Tobago.

Added to the allure of the fair's unique way to view, interact with, and purchase art, the team behind the
fair has secured the first art fair appearance of Obvious - the three 25-year-olds that are shaking up the art
world with the use of ink, canvas and a complex artificial algorithm to create an A.I. created image. The
collective will have three pieces up for sale - one of which was recently purchased by a prominent New
York collector, in addition to a scheduled talk sharing the process behind the first A.I. generated art piece
during Art Fort Lauderdale's artDISCOURSE Series taking place at NSU Art Museum (Horvitz
Auditorium) on Sunday, January 27th at 2:30 pm.

The 2019 exhibitors were chosen by our Co-Founder | Director (artINDIE I and artINDIE II), Jen Clay
and Sarah Michelle Rupert (artINTERACTIVE / interactive playhouse), and Lisa Rockford
(artCURATED).

The show is bringing back its first year artINTERACTIVE home with the help of the talented curators of
Interactive Initiatives (Jen Clay and Sarah Michelle Rupert) who will fill the entire home with immersive
and interactive art projects by local and national artists. In addition, the 2019 fair will debut
artCURATED - a home curated by the fair's first guest curator, Lisa Rockford - who is using the idea of a
single enclosure with adjacent rooms as stimulus to create a journey for the viewer, staging the property
with works that translate elements of life and existence for reflection.

About Art Fort Lauderdale


Art Fort Lauderdale is a four-day curated art fair that transports attendees on a journey along the famed
Intracoastal waterways via water taxi and private yacht with stops at vacant luxury waterfront properties
that feature over 100 artists and galleries exhibiting various styles and methods of art that reflect the past,
the present and the future. This destination art fair seeks to highlight the uniqueness of the city and put
Fort Lauderdale on the art world map as a premier location to view, interact with and purchase art along
with giving art aficionados, residents and visitors a cultural experience that is memorable, interactive and
